Alahamamra’s Reviews > How Nonviolent Struggle Works > Status Update

Alahamamra
Alahamamra is on page 25 of 148
Nov 12, 2015 01:11PM
How Nonviolent Struggle Works

flag

Alahamamra’s Previous Updates

Alahamamra
Alahamamra is on page 25 of 148
100
Nov 13, 2015 12:11AM
How Nonviolent Struggle Works


No comments have been added yet.